Team News: Cardiff City, Bristol City unchanged for Severnside derby

Joe Ralls returns to an otherwise unchanged Cardiff City squad, while Bristol City also name the same XI who featured in their last outing.

Cardiff City have welcomed back Joe Ralls to their matchday squad for this evening's Severnside derby meeting against Bristol City.

The Bluebirds are otherwise unchanged, with Kenwyne Jones still missing out due to an injury picked up on international duty.

It is a similar story for the visitors, who themselves stick with the same XI from the 2-1 defeat at Brighton & Hove Albion last time out.

There is no place in the Robins' squad for recent Wales call-up Wes Burns, though, as he misses out on the 18-man squad altogether.

Cardiff, who have won six of the last eight encounters between these two sides, can move within one point of the playoffs with victory this evening.

Cardiff City: Marshall; Peltier, Connolly, Morrison, Fabio; Noone, Gunnarsson, Dikgacoi, Whittingham; Mason, Revell
Subs: Moore, Malone, Tamas, O'Keefe, Pilkington, Ralls, Ameobi

Bristol City: Fielding; Bennett, Ayling, Flint, Baker; Williams, Smith, Pack, Freeman; Wilbraham, Kodjia
Subs: Hamer, Little, Reid, Bryan, Cox, Moore, Agard
